Congress to support NC in Rajya Sabha polls ‘to Keep BJP Out’: Tariq Karra

Srinagar, Oct 23 (KNS): Ending days of speculation over its stand, the Jammu and Kashmir Pradesh Congress Committee on Thursday said that all six of its legislators will vote in favour of the National Conference candidates in Friday’s Rajya Sabha elections, calling the decision a “moral stand” to keep the BJP away from power.

Addressing a press conference in Srinagar, JKPCC President Tariq Hameed Karra said the party had held two rounds of discussions, one on Wednesday and another earlier on Thursday, before finalising the decision in consultation with the party’s central leadership in New Delhi.

“Having taken into account our own sensitivities as a suffering state, and as a steadfast secular party, we have decided to keep all differences with the National Conference on the back burner only to prove our commitment to our own ethos,” Karra said.

He said the Congress had chosen the “path of principle over expediency” despite its grievances with the NC over seat-sharing and coordination within the alliance. “Rajya Sabha polls this time have come as a challenge. We wish that the NC keeps its flock together against all temptations and manipulations, for which we offer our support,” he said.

“It is this larger cause and our fight with the BJP at the national level that we ignore being guided by the treatment we were meted out from the National Conference as an ally,” he added.

Karra said that all six Congress MLAs, Ghulam Amir, Peerzada Mohammad Sayeed, Nizamuddin Bhat, Advocate Irfan Hafeez Lone, and Iftikhar Ahmed were part of the deliberations and had unanimously endorsed the decision. “We direct our honourable members to cast their votes in favour of the National Conference candidate in the Rajya Sabha. A party whip has also been issued,” he said as per KNS.

The JKPCC chief also appreciated NC candidate Shammi Oberoi for his constructive approach during talks between the two parties. “Mr. Shammi Oberoi, as interlocutor, turned negotiations into understanding and differences into dialogue,” Karra said.

He added that the party would soon release two formal communications addressed to NC President Dr. Farooq Abdullah, outlining the terms of their understanding and their shared vision for the alliance.(KNS)
